Haas sponsor Rich Energy hit with multiple court orders!
Haas sponsor Rich Energy has been hit with several UK court orders, one of which compels the energy drink company to provide clarity on its financial situation and its dealings with Haas. Rich Energy was brought to court by British bicycle company Whyte Bikes for a copyright infringement involving its stag logo which appeared as almost an exact copy of the cycling company's emblem. A ruling by the Intellectual Property Enterprise Court, which declared Rich Energy's stag logo as invalid, forbids the company from using its logo in the United Kingdom after July 18.
